Our mission is to amplify human creativity and intelligence. NVIDIA is looking for an Orbital Datacenter System Architect to help define and build products for AI in orbit. This is an opportunity to join the leader in AI systems at the inception of a completely new industry.
What you will be doing:
-
Drive architecture for orbital datacenter systems considering everything from the chip out to the satellite and connectivity between satellites
-
Work with counterparts from silicon, software, networking, operations, and other teams to build a roadmap that guides development of future NVIDIA products for space
-
Analyze performance, power, and cost of different solutions to inform architectural decisions
-
Collaborate with NVIDIA’s key customers and system development partners to align on consistent strategies
-
Collaborate with suppliers and procurement teams to ensure industry roadmaps are aligned to NVIDIA needs
-
Work across engineering and operations teams to define systems from concept through large production deployments
-
Summarize and examine competitor solutions to keep track of industry developments and trends
What we need to see:
-
Bachelor's Degree in Computer Engineering, Computer Science, Electrical Engineering, or equivalent experience in related fields. MS or equivalent experience preferred
-
Deep understanding of hardware architecture and development of computing systems for space, including reliability, radiation tolerant strategies, environmental tolerances, and thermal solutions
-
12+ years or more of experience in system architecture.
-
Hands-on experience with testing and validation for space systems
-
Excellent presentation and verbal communication skills with proven ability to lead multi-discipline teams
Ways to stand out from the crowd:
-
Experience with large projects involving co-development of silicon, systems, and software
-
Familiarity with GPU compute and NVIDIA products
-
Experience solving mechanical challenges for rocket launches
-
Experience with beam testing and silicon features required for use in space
